Boer War Service
1 Oct 1899: | Involvement Private, 147, 5th Queensland Imperial Bushmen | |
---|---|---|
6 Mar 1901: | Embarked Australian and Colonial Military Forces - Boer War Contingents, Private, 147, 5th Queensland Imperial Bushmen, AWM Boer War Unit Details, Murray p. 488 notes 5th QIB embarked at Pinkenba 6 Mar 1901 aboard Templemore arriving Port Elizabeth 1 Apr 1901. | |
5 May 1902: | Discharged Australian and Colonial Military Forces - Boer War Contingents, Private, 147, 5th Queensland Imperial Bushmen, Qld State Archives- Boer War Service Paybooks 5th QIB notes returned to Australia aboard Columbian arriving Brisbane 15 May 1902 having been discharged 5 May 1902 when unit was disbanded. |

Charles Ernest Walden was born on 23 Dec 1879 in Queensland, a son to Thomas Walden and Eliza Walden (nee Howard). When he enlisted in 1901 in the 5th QIB he noted his N.O.K. as his father Thomas Walden at Woolloongabba. He married Elizabeth Albertina Berry and they had 2 children.
